Progressive Web Apps (PWAs): Are They Replacing Native Apps?
Introduction
Mobile applications have become a fundamental part of how businesses interact with customers, deliver services, and build digital ecosystems. As organizations continue to expand their mobile presence, many are evaluating whether Progressive Web Apps replacing native apps is a realistic direction for future development strategies. Progressive Web Apps (PWAs) combine the accessibility of web technology with many capabilities traditionally associated with mobile applications, creating a new model for delivering digital experiences.
For business leaders and technology decision-makers, the question is not simply about choosing a technology stack. It is about optimizing user experience, controlling development costs, and ensuring scalability across multiple devices and platforms. As mobile usage continues to dominate global internet traffic, companies must determine whether traditional native applications remain the best solution or if modern web technologies offer a more flexible alternative.
This article explores the strategic implications of Progressive Web Apps, compares them with native applications, and evaluates whether businesses should view PWAs as a replacement or a complementary technology in their digital transformation journey.
Understanding Progressive Web Apps and Native Applications
Before evaluating the discussion around Progressive Web Apps replacing native apps, it is essential to understand how these two approaches differ in design, functionality, and development strategy.
What Are Progressive Web Apps?
Progressive Web Apps are web-based applications designed to deliver app-like experiences directly through a browser. They are built using standard web technologies such as HTML, CSS, and JavaScript but enhanced with modern browser capabilities that allow them to behave similarly to mobile apps.
Key capabilities of PWAs include:
-
Offline access through service workers
-
Push notifications
-
Installable experience without an app store
-
Fast loading performance
-
Responsive design across devices
According to Google’s official PWA documentation, the goal of PWAs is to create reliable, fast, and engaging user experiences that function effectively even in limited connectivity environments.
What Are Native Mobile Apps?
Native applications are built specifically for a particular operating system such as iOS or Android. These applications are developed using platform-specific programming languages and frameworks.
Common technologies include:
-
Swift or Objective-C for Apple’s iOS platform
-
Kotlin or Java for Android development
Native apps are installed directly from app stores and have full access to device hardware, including cameras, sensors, GPS systems, and advanced graphics capabilities. This deep integration allows them to deliver highly optimized performance for complex mobile experiences.
Why Businesses Are Considering Progressive Web Apps
The growing interest in Progressive Web Apps replacing native apps is largely driven by business efficiency, development flexibility, and improved accessibility for users.
Reduced Development Costs
Building native applications for multiple platforms can require separate development teams, different technology stacks, and continuous maintenance. This often leads to increased costs and longer development cycles.
PWAs provide a unified development approach. Businesses can build a single web application that functions across devices and operating systems.
Benefits include:
-
Lower initial development costs
-
Reduced maintenance complexity
-
Faster product updates
-
Simplified cross-platform compatibility
Organizations working with digital strategy partners such as IQC Solutions® often evaluate PWA architecture when clients want to launch scalable applications without maintaining multiple codebases.
Faster Updates and Deployment
One major limitation of native applications is the dependency on app store approvals for updates. Even minor changes can take days or weeks to reach users.
PWAs allow developers to deploy updates directly through the web server. This provides businesses with greater control over product evolution and significantly faster iteration cycles.
For companies operating in competitive markets, the ability to release features quickly can be a major advantage.
Performance Considerations in the Progressive Web Apps vs Native Apps Debate
While Progressive Web Apps offer several advantages, performance remains an important factor in determining whether they can fully replace native applications.
When Native Apps Still Have the Advantage
Native apps generally deliver superior performance in scenarios involving:
-
High-performance gaming
-
Advanced animations or graphics
-
Real-time processing
-
Deep hardware integration
Because native applications run directly on the operating system, they can fully utilize device resources. This makes them ideal for applications that require intensive computing power.
For example, mobile games, augmented reality experiences, and complex enterprise productivity tools often rely on native performance capabilities.
How PWAs Are Closing the Gap
Modern web technologies have significantly improved PWA performance. Advanced caching strategies, optimized frameworks, and improved browser capabilities have narrowed the gap between web and native experiences.
Many well-known companies have successfully adopted PWAs to improve user engagement. According to research from Google developers, businesses implementing PWAs often see improvements in loading speed, user retention, and mobile conversion rates.
For applications focused on content delivery, e-commerce, or service platforms, PWAs can deliver performance that is comparable to native apps.
Strategic Benefits of Progressive Web Apps for Businesses
Beyond technical performance, the strategic advantages of PWAs are driving adoption across industries.
Improved Accessibility and Reach
One of the strongest arguments in the discussion about Progressive Web Apps replacing native apps is accessibility. Users can access PWAs directly from a browser without installing an application.
This eliminates several barriers:
-
No dependency on app store downloads
-
Reduced device storage requirements
-
Instant access through a link
For businesses trying to reach global audiences, especially in regions with limited bandwidth or lower-end devices, this accessibility can significantly expand their digital reach.
Enhanced Mobile Performance
PWAs are designed with performance optimization in mind. Through service workers and intelligent caching, they can load quickly even in unstable network conditions.
According to research from McKinsey & Company, fast and reliable digital experiences are directly linked to higher customer engagement and improved conversion rates. PWAs can support these outcomes by minimizing latency and improving responsiveness.
Simplified Cross-Platform Strategy
Developing separate applications for multiple operating systems increases both cost and complexity.
A single PWA can function across:
-
Mobile devices
-
Tablets
-
Desktop browsers
This unified experience simplifies development while ensuring consistency across digital platforms.
Businesses exploring scalable digital platforms often partner with firms such as IQC Solutions® to evaluate whether PWA architecture aligns with their long-term digital infrastructure strategy.
When Businesses Should Choose Native Applications
Despite the advantages of PWAs, there are situations where native applications remain the better choice.
High-Performance Applications
Industries requiring intensive graphical performance or real-time data processing typically benefit from native development.
Examples include:
-
Gaming applications
-
Augmented reality or virtual reality platforms
-
Advanced financial trading applications
-
Complex productivity software
These use cases require deeper integration with operating systems and hardware resources.
Applications Dependent on Device Hardware
Some mobile features are still better supported through native development, including:
-
Advanced camera processing
-
Bluetooth device integration
-
Biometric authentication
-
Advanced background processing
While PWAs continue to evolve, native platforms still provide more comprehensive access to hardware capabilities.
The Future of Progressive Web Apps and Native Development
Rather than completely replacing native applications, PWAs are increasingly becoming part of a hybrid digital strategy.
Many organizations are adopting a layered approach:
-
PWAs for accessible, cross-platform experiences
-
Native apps for high-performance or hardware-intensive features
This strategy allows businesses to balance accessibility, performance, and development efficiency.
According to industry analysis from Gartner, organizations pursuing digital transformation should prioritize flexible technology architectures that allow applications to evolve alongside changing user expectations.
In practice, this means businesses should evaluate application requirements carefully before choosing a development approach.
Conclusion
The conversation around Progressive Web Apps replacing native apps reflects a broader shift in how businesses approach digital development. PWAs offer significant advantages in accessibility, development efficiency, and cross-platform compatibility. For many service platforms, e-commerce applications, and content-driven products, they can provide an excellent alternative to traditional mobile applications.
However, native applications remain essential for high-performance use cases and advanced hardware integration. Rather than viewing PWAs as a complete replacement, businesses should consider them as a strategic addition to their digital ecosystem.
By carefully evaluating performance needs, user experience expectations, and long-term scalability, organizations can determine the right balance between web and native technologies. As digital platforms continue to evolve, companies that adopt flexible and forward-thinking development strategies will be best positioned to deliver exceptional mobile experiences.
